Overview

Dnipro VC is a venture capital firm headquartered in Palo Alto, California, dedicated to investing in early-stage startups, particularly those founded or co-founded by Ukrainians. Established to provide capital and support to global founders, Dnipro VC focuses on groundbreaking technologies in artificial intelligence (AI) and cybersecurity. The firm is committed to enhancing automation and protecting data through its investments.

Currently, Dnipro VC manages a portfolio of 20 companies, emphasizing its role in the global startup ecosystem. The firm primarily invests at the seed and Series A stages, targeting innovative solutions that address real-world challenges. Dnipro VC aims to back 25 to 35 startups annually, reflecting its active engagement in the market.

In addition to its investment activities, Dnipro VC is known for its strong network and resources, which it leverages to support portfolio companies in scaling their operations. The firm’s geographic focus includes North America and global markets, aligning with its mission to empower Ukrainian entrepreneurs with global ambitions.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are Dnipro VC's investment criteria?

Dnipro VC focuses on early-stage companies in AI and cybersecurity, particularly those founded or co-founded by Ukrainians. The firm looks for strong technical teams, early product development, and customer traction.

How can I pitch to Dnipro VC?

Founders can pitch Dnipro VC via email at info@dnipro.vc. While warm introductions are preferred, the firm does review cold applications.

What makes Dnipro VC different from other investors?

Dnipro VC specifically targets Ukrainian-founded startups and emphasizes a strong connection to the Ukrainian entrepreneurial community. The firm also focuses on groundbreaking technologies in AI and cybersecurity.

What is the typical check size for investments?

Dnipro VC typically invests between $50,000 and several million dollars, depending on the stage and potential of the startup.

What geographic areas does Dnipro VC focus on?

While based in Palo Alto, California, Dnipro VC invests globally, with a particular emphasis on North America and Ukrainian-founded startups.

What kind of support does Dnipro VC provide to portfolio companies?

Dnipro VC offers operational support, access to its network, and guidance on scaling and hiring, particularly for companies looking to expand in the U.S. market.
